🏥 Biddy Mason, a healer, midwife, philanthropist, and California’s first Black nurse, was featured in Bernard Zakheim’s murals at @UCSF. From delivering babies to fighting epidemics, her legacy of courage and compassion continues to inspire.

UCSF’s Archives and Special Collections has played a key role in preserving documentation from the HIV/AIDS epidemic, first initiating the AIDS History Project in 1987.

🗃️Project Archivist Edith Escobedo @ucsf_library processed Levy’s virology research dating back to 1964. The collection includes lab notebooks, videotapes, cassettes, notes, posters, correspondence, and awards in 30 cartons. Details here:
